Megan's interview


How did all start?

Voluntary mammogram aged 40. Followed by ultrasounds, fine needle biopsy, then core tissue biopsy. Referral to a surgeon and removal of lesions within 3mths

Do you already have a diagnosis? How long did it take you to get it?

5 lesion removals over last two years. 4 confirmed benign rumours. 5 more lesions present. Appeared within 3mths if last surgery.

What has been the most useful thing for you so far?

Regular check-ups. Three to six months.

What have been your biggest difficulties?

Infection after first surgery. Regular recurrence, with in crease in lesions each time. 2, then 3, now 5

How has your social and family environment reacted? Have your social or family relationships changed?

Yes, changed. Worry, stress.

What do you think about the future?

Surgery, mastectomy, death

Finally, what advice would you give to a person in a similar situation?

See a specialist regularly. Donate your tissue for research
